| Signage: | Section 31 of the Constitution defines the right of individuals to enjoy their culture, practise their religion, use their language and belong to any cultural, religious or linguistic association of their choice. Verster depicts this through an abstract exploration. The hand gestures suggest communication, writing, art-making, making an oath, and prayer. |
